Percona Backup for MongoDB 1.6.0¶
Date:August 16, 2021 Installation:Installing Percona Backup for MongoDBPercona Backup for MongoDB is a distributed, low-impact solution for consistent backups of MongoDB sharded clusters and replica sets. This is a tool for creating consistent backups across a MongoDB sharded cluster (or a single replica set), and for restoring those backups to a specific point in time.
Release highlights:
- Support for Percona Server for MongoDB and MongoDB Community 5.0
- Point-in-time recovery enhancements: ability to restore from any previous snapshot and configurable span of oplog events
- JSON output for PBM commands to simplify interfacing PBM with applications
Improvements¶
- PBM-543: Configure the size of the span of oplog events for point-in-time recovery
- PBM-403: Mask user credentials in
ps
output ofpbm-agent
- PBM-700: Improve backup/pitr tasks synchronization and align oplogs creation
- PBM-697: Add support of MongoDB 5.0 TS collections
- PBM-686: Do not show the starting second of a PITR range which cannot be used for PITR restore
- PBM-652: Add a command to delete PITR chunks
- PBM-632: Add JSON output for all commands
Bugs Fixed¶
- PBM-694: Fix restoring from a backup when it contains VIEWS collection (Thanks to Danish Qamar for reporting this issue)
- PBM-647: Reduce frequency of S3 header GET requests during agent health checks (Thanks to Ryan Gunner for reporting this issue)
- PBM-708: Ignore config.system.indexBuilds collection
- PBM-705: Avoid writing the “Read/Write on closed pipe” error in logs on expected connection closure
- PBM-703: PITR restore fails due to error “Failed to apply operation due to missing collection config.transactions”
- PBM-701: Prevent restore to time which is not covered by PITR chunks
- PBM-683: Show PITR restore as failed if an error occurred during data retrieval from storage
